Tyree Wilson promises to ‘continue to get better’
Candice Ward-Imagn Images

For Tyree Wilson, 2025 has all the makings of a make-or-break year for his NFL future.

The seventh overall pick in the 2023 Draft, Wilson’s first two seasons in the NFL have been a mixed bag. Despite showing flashes of his raw potential, it has never seemed to shine through on a consistent basis. With only eight sacks to his credit so far, Wilson was going to have to improve to impress a new coaching staff and front office.

Fortunately for the Las Vegas Raiders, Wilson is playing like a man who knows exactly what the stakes are for him.

The progress made by Wilson this offseason suggest a breakout is coming.

After Wednesday’s training camp session, Wilson spoke about how he has improved in his game.

“I mean, y’all watch the tape, just like I do,” Wilson said on Wednesday, via the Las Vegas Review-Journal. “I feel like I’m playing faster, way more fluid than I have been before. And it’s going to continue to get better.”

If there was ever a time for Wilson to prove he can make an impact at the NFL level, this is the season to do it.

With the sudden release of defensive tackle Christian Wilkins, Wilson has been called upon to kick inside in certain situations. The idea of using him as a defensive tackle to create mismatches is interesting, as Wilson’s mix of length and athleticism is unique to that position. From what he has showcased so far, the opportunity for increased playing time is there and, by proxy, increased production.

“We’ve called on him in a number of ways to keep going, keep pushing,” Raiders head coach Pete Carroll said on Wednesday. “We’re really trying to make sure that we put him in the right spots that take advantage of his skills and his comfort and so that he can play at his best.”

A third-year breakout would be an ideal scenario for both Wilson and the Raiders, ensuring the talented defensive lineman a place in the emerging young core for years to come.
